Driving Research Quality with Robust Data Collection To enhance research quality in clinical studies, robust data collection is essential. Crafting well-designed clinical questions plays a central role in gathering rich, valuable data. Effective question design minimizes biases, ensures clarity, and improves the reliability of collected data. When questions are thoughtfully constructed, they help eliminate ambiguities, allowing researchers to extract consistent and insightful information. Accurate and Clear Questions: Ambiguity in questions can lead to inconsistent data. Questions must be easy to understand to avoid misinterpretation and provide meaningful responses. Avoiding Bias: Neutral phrasing is critical to prevent leading respondents toward a particular answer. Bias can skew data, affecting the study’s validity. Relevance to Objectives: Each question should align with the study's goals. Irrelevant questions can dilute the focus and make data less useful. Open vs. Closed Questions: Open-ended questions yield qualitative insights, while closed-ended questions facilitate quantitative analysis. Balancing both types can capture comprehensive data. Adhering to these principles ensures the collection of high-quality, reliable data crucial for drawing valid conclusions in clinical research. In turn, this drives the overall quality and impact of the research conducted. Understanding Thematic Analysis Approaches Thematic analysis is a foundational method for interpreting qualitative data, allowing researchers to identify, analyze, and report patterns within data. It provides a structured approach to understanding multifaceted data by highlighting prevalent themes. There are two primary thematic analysis approaches: inductive and deductive. Inductive thematic analysis involves generating themes directly from the data without preconceived theories, making it data-driven. This approach is flexible and lets themes emerge naturally, aiding in exploring novel insights. Deductive thematic analysis, on the other hand, starts with pre-determined themes based on existing theories or literature, making it theory-driven. This structured method allows for targeted analysis, ensuring alignment with specific research questions. Choosing the correct analysis approach hinges on your research objective. If your study aims to explore new phenomena, an inductive approach may be preferable. Conversely, if you aim to test or extend existing theories, a deductive approach would be more suitable. Understanding these thematic analysis approaches helps in making an informed selection, ultimately enhancing the reliability and richness of your research findings. Pros and Cons of Inductive vs. Deductive Thematic Analysis Inductive thematic analysis emphasizes deriving themes from raw data without preconceived categories, which allows for flexibility and discovery of new insights. This approach is beneficial for exploratory research where the aim is to understand patterns emerging directly from the data. However, it can be time-consuming and requires thorough immersion in the data, potentially leading to researcher bias as themes are formed based on the researcher’s interpretations. Conversely, deductive thematic analysis involves using predefined categories to analyze data, making it more structured and efficient. This approach is advantageous when the research focuses on testing existing theories or hypotheses. However, it may limit the discovery of unexpected patterns, as the analysis is confined to predetermined themes. Techniques for Thematic Refinement: Coding and Re-coding Coding and re-coding are integral techniques in thematic refinement, allowing for a deeper understanding of the data. Initially, coding involves identifying patterns and assigning labels to meaningful units of text. This stage creates an organized framework to understand recurring themes. However, the first round of coding is rarely perfect; thus, re-coding becomes necessary. Re-coding refines these preliminary codes, ensuring they accurately capture the essence of the data. This iterative process might involve merging similar codes, subdividing broad categories, or even reassessing the interpretive lens. Through re-coding, themes become more precise and reflective of the underlying patterns. Overall, these techniques are essential for synthesizing complex qualitative data into coherent themes, enhancing the reliability and depth of thematic analysis. Key Steps in Thematic Analysis Thematic analysis is a method for identifying, analyzing, and interpreting patterns within qualitative data. When applying thematic analysis to secondary data, such as pre-existing interviews or textual documents, it’s essential to follow several key steps to ensure rigor and reliability. These steps can help you uncover deep insights and produce a comprehensive thematic review. Familiarization with Data: Begin by thoroughly reading your data to understand the context and content. This step is crucial for immersing yourself in the data, enabling an intuitive sense of the patterns and themes that may emerge. Generating Initial Codes: As you familiarize yourself with the data, start noting down initial codes. These codes represent significant features of the data that appear interesting or relevant to your research questions. Searching for Themes: After generating initial codes, group these codes into potential themes. A theme is a pattern that captures something significant or interesting about the data in relation to the research question. Reviewing Themes: It’s important to review and refine the themes to ensure they accurately reflect the coded data. This step involves checking if the themes effectively represent the data and if there are any overlaps or redundancies. Defining and Naming Themes: Clearly define each theme and develop a name that encapsulates the essence of the theme. Detailed descriptions help in understanding the boundaries and content of each theme. Producing the Report: Finally, document the findings by producing a detailed report. This report should include vivid examples and a coherent narrative that links back to the research questions and overall objectives. By following these key steps, researchers can apply thematic analysis techniques systematically to secondary data, allowing for meaningful and trustworthy insights.
